Using your brain boosts your immune system and keeps you healthy
by Mike Adams, the Health Ranger, NaturalNews Editor
The mind/body connection is real: new research shows that a healthy, active brain boosts your immune system function and helps keep you healthy.
- According to a new study from the University of Wisconsin-Madison, it also may involve a particular pattern of brain activity. Numerous scientific studies show that keeping a positive attitude can keep a person healthy, says Richard Davidson, a UW-Madison neuroscientist and senior author of the paper. Specifically, the scientists wanted to know if people who showed more activity in the left side of the prefrontal cortex - a part of the brain associated with positive emotional responses - also showed greater immunity to the influenza virus after vaccination. As the respondents focused on the emotion experienced for one minute, the researchers measured the electrical activity in both the right and left sides of the prefrontal cortex.
